Redwood Creek Trail

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

The Redwood Creek Trail is the main pathway through Muir Woods National Monument and connects to several other trails. It is an easy and beautiful route for a casual stroll as you admire the impressive, towering redwoods.

Dipsea Steps

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

These stairs ascend to the renowned Dipsea Trail. They consist of a total of 680 steps divided into three sections, which have been in existence since the early 1900s and were recently restored.
